Output faf5aed3cddb4a638690797ecb34d04d96b921ae834141f764047549afd754e6:185

value
66477
script pubkey
OP_0 OP_PUSHBYTES_20 d38feaf761645e1a5c55c3583423078e5b03573c
address
bc1q6w874ampv30p5hz4cdvrggc83edsx4eukckw6x
transaction
faf5aed3cddb4a638690797ecb34d04d96b921ae834141f764047549afd754e6